Dustin Burke

Mathematics, Computer Science

Dustin Burke is a Boston-area Software Architect and Research Engineer at Milcord LLC, with rapid prototyping skills and experience with all aspects of managing, researching and developing innovative software solutions. He's a graduate of Boston University Class of 2006 with dual degrees in Mathematics and Computer Science. Dustin began working for Milcord in 2006 as a Software Engineer and has successfully managed numerous Small Business Innovative Research (SBIR) projects.
